Agricultural planting and livestock and poultry aquaculture are highly sensitive to environmental temperature. Low temperature frost and temperature fluctuations can hinder the normal growth of plants and animals. Traditional insulation methods have uneven temperature control, which can easily lead to growth differences, low survival rates, and other operational issues. Electric heat tracing and constant temperature technology are suitable for various agricultural scenarios, providing precise and stable temperature control, and helping to stabilize agricultural production and increase yields.

Facility greenhouse planting is the main application scenario of electric heat tracing. Winter low temperature and late spring cold weather, coupled with insufficient soil temperature, can lead to dormancy of crop roots, resulting in problems such as root rot, growth stagnation, and low fruit hanging rate. Traditional cotton quilts and film insulation can only maintain surface temperature, while deep soil layers have slow heating and large temperature differences. After laying a low-temperature self limiting electric heating belt, the planting soil and seedling substrate can be continuously heated at a constant temperature, stabilizing the ground temperature within the suitable growth range of crops and not affected by external low-temperature weather. Whether it is the cultivation of fruits and vegetables, flower seedlings, or traditional Chinese medicine, off-season planting can be achieved, effectively shortening the growth cycle and improving crop yield and quality.
The precise temperature control advantage of electric heat tracing is particularly prominent for the cultivation of special and precious plants. Some tropical green plants and rare seedlings are extremely sensitive to temperature, and even slight low temperatures can cause wilting and frostbite. Self limiting temperature with automatic adjustment of tropical temperature, without local overheating and root burning, suitable for precision cultivation environment in greenhouses. At the same time, the cable is waterproof, moisture-proof, and corrosion-resistant, suitable for high humidity environments in greenhouses. It is not easily aged or damaged when laid in the soil for a long time, with simple operation and maintenance, lower energy consumption, and is more energy-efficient and stable compared to traditional heating equipment.
In aquaculture, electric heating belts are commonly used for water insulation and pipeline antifreeze. Aquaculture species such as fish, shrimp, and crabs have extremely low tolerance to changes in water temperature, and are prone to widespread stress, frostbite, and death in autumn, winter, and early morning temperatures. Laying a heat tracing strip on the outside of the breeding pool pipeline and water circulation equipment, coupled with a temperature controller for precise temperature control, can stabilize the water temperature and avoid low-temperature freezing damage. At the same time, it can solve the problem of winter freezing and blockage in the breeding water replenishment pipeline and filtration pipeline, ensure the normal operation of the water circulation system around the clock, and avoid water and production shutdowns in breeding.
The livestock and poultry breeding scene relies on electric heat tracing to achieve constant temperature breeding. Piglets, chicks and other young animals have weak physical fitness, and the survival rate in low-temperature environments has significantly decreased. Traditional baking lamps have high energy consumption and uneven heating, and there is also a risk of fire. The breeding house is equipped with a dedicated low-temperature heating belt, which can achieve constant temperature heating on the ground, with uniform and soft temperature, suitable for the growth environment of young cubs. A stable temperature can reduce the stress response of livestock and poultry, lower the incidence of diseases, improve the survival rate of breeding, while avoiding the safety risks of open flame heating, and adapting to the standardized operation of large-scale breeding farms.
The electric heat tracing belts used in agricultural scenarios are all low-pressure and low-temperature specialized models, with high safety and strong adaptability. Different from industrial high-temperature cables, agricultural heat tracing cables have gentle temperature rise, waterproof and flame-retardant properties, and are suitable for soil, water, and humid greenhouse environments. They will not burn animals or plants, nor pose any safety hazards. Equipped with intelligent temperature control devices for automatic start stop and on-demand heating, it significantly reduces agricultural insulation energy consumption and offers a much better cost-effectiveness than traditional heating methods.
In summary, electric heat tracing effectively compensates for many shortcomings of traditional agricultural insulation. With the advantages of safety, energy saving, precise temperature control, and easy operation and maintenance, it is suitable for various scenarios such as planting, aquaculture, and livestock. Scientifically deploying electric heat tracing systems can stabilize the growth environment of animals and plants, and help promote the large-scale and efficient development of modern agriculture.
